More information is required to make a meaningful diagnosis of your issue, but I will try to address what is the likely and obvious cause of this without you having to do so.

If you are running Android 4.4.- or higher, you will not be able to run Rockbox on your device, at all, period.

If you are running Android 4.3 or lesser (If you are, why? Please don't*.) and have manually elected to use the ART runtime engine over the Dalvik runtime engine, you will also not be able to run Rockbox on this device without reverting to the Dalvik runtime engine.
